- In this tutorial I will walk you through each step of making this medieval fabric with Substance Designer. You can follow along using the same files as me by downloading them here: www.drive.google.com/uc?expor... , but you can also use your own!
If you're already at ease with Designer this video might be a bit slow-paced for you :) On the other hand if you're only getting started and know nothing about nodes, I suggest you watch the Substance Academy initiation course before jumping into this one.
--- Content ---
00:00 Intro
00:22 Setting up the graph
02:42 Creating the first weft
07:29 Creating the second weft
14:00 Creating a mask to distribute our wefts
18:50 Making the mask more organic and realistic
26:52 Adding wrinkles to the fabric
31:11 Building the other maps
32:20 Building the base color
39:40 Building the metallic map
42:22 Building the roughness map
46:14 Conclusion
